视频 cdn 加速什么原理

2016-09-13 21:25:16 +08:00
 holinhot

切片后的视频 cdn 加速好理解。 可不切片的视频文件怎么加速的。 例如源服务器 1.mp4 500MB 使用 cdn,如腾讯 cdn 不可能给我 500MB 缓存的空间。这样一来就根本无法缓存这个视频文件。每次用户访问 cdn 都要向源服务器请求,根本无法省流量,况且视频加载速度还要看 cdn 节点和源服务器的连接速度。

还有如果腾讯 cdn 能缓存超过 500MB 的文件,那么如果用户观看 5 分钟就关掉了,那缓存的这 5 分钟在第二个用户观看前 5 分钟是否需要向源服务器请求。还是要完整缓存整个文件后第二个用户观看才不用向源服务器请求。 如果两个用户同时观看同时观看同一视频。将如何缓存

6326 次点击
所在节点    CDN
3 条回复
LGA1150
2016-09-14 01:37:52 +08:00
1 、腾讯不是有专门的音视频加速 CDN 吗? https://www.qcloud.com/product/cdn.html
2 、取决于缓存策略,有些是一下子回源完,有些是按量
Livid
2016-09-14 10:12:59 +08:00
对于大文件, CDN 可以开启切片回源和存储。

最近 Nginx 官方也提供了一个这样的模块:

https://nginx.org/en/docs/http/ngx_http_slice_module.html
holinhot
2016-09-14 15:32:51 +08:00

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/306033

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X